C++ program to reverse a single linked list

In this program, we have share c++ program to reverse a single linked list with the output. Given the pointer/reference to the head of a singly linked listreverse it and return the pointer/reference to the head of reversed linked list.

What is singly linked list c++?

Singly linked list is a linear collection of data elements, whose order is not given by their physical placement in memory. Instead, each element points to the next. It is a data structure consisting of a collection of nodes which together represent a sequence.

what is single linked list

C++ program to reverse a single linked list

Copy the below C++ program and execute it with the help of GCC compiler. At the end of this program, We have shared the output of this program.

Program output:

If you like FreeWebMentor and you would like to contribute, you can write an article and mail your article to [email protected] Your article will appear on the FreeWebMentor main page and help other developers.

Recommended Posts:


Editorial Staff

Editorial Staff at FreeWebMentor is a team of professional developers.


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.